Buy NowComputechnodigitronic draws on the visual language of 1980s LED and LCD displays without copying the mechanics of an actual segmented system. Its angled notches and machine-like rhythm suggest an electronic alphabet developed for hardware that never reached production.
Electronic instruments and equipment provide a natural setting. Computechnodigitronic can label synthesizer controls, effects units, audio-plugin interfaces, robotics kits, laboratory instruments, DIY electronics, and fictional control panels. Model numbers, operating modes, parameter names, warning headings, and readouts can all share the same fabricated hardware logic.
Its connection to digital timing displays makes it especially effective for sports. Track-and-field posters, lane assignments, starting lists, split-time tables, finish-line graphics, personal-best records, and stadium displays can carry the event and its results in a consistent electronic style. The monospaced numerals keep times, scores, measurements, prices, and percentages aligned in vertical columns.
Calculator displays suggest a different numerical territory. Market-data graphics, investment-report covers, trading simulations, financial-technology campaigns, economic conferences, and calculator interfaces can use Computechnodigitronic to make figures look processed and continuously updated. Its associations are closer to calculation and electronic readouts than to the sober authority of conventional financial typography.
Computer-history exhibitions, vintage-technology articles, arcade graphics, electronic-music packaging, software retrospectives, and science-fiction props can also draw on its invented digital history. Rather than reproducing one particular machine, Computechnodigitronic recalls an era when calculators, digital watches, stereo components, and home computers appeared to be developing a new alphabet together.
Its conspicuous construction is best suited to headlines, labels, captions, short quotations, and several lines of large display copy. A restrained sans serif or conventional monospace can handle longer explanations while Computechnodigitronic marks commands, specifications, event titles, and prominent data.
